**About Us**

Since 1986, Neighbour to Neighbour (N2N) Centre has been working to lead our community to an improved quality of life. What started as a small food bank has evolved into an indispensable part of Hamilton’s social fabric. N2N gets to the very root of our community’s needs, offering access to healthy food, skill building programs, tutoring for children, utility support programs, counselling and a host of other interventions.
